Title:
Texas Department of Agriculture audiovisual materials
Description:
The Texas Department of Agriculture (TDA) promotes production agriculture, consumer protection, economic development, and healthy living. TDA's Office of Communications provides media information and keeps the public informed of TDA activities and agriculture issues via traditional and social media channels. These 16 mm motion picture films and digital copies of the original audiotape and video recordings document the department's activities, including many of the agency's programs and events, public appearances of commissioners Jim Hightower and Rick Perry, and interviews with agricultural producers in Texas, dating 1969-1999 and undated. The majority of the 16 mm motion picture recordings have been digitized and along with the digital copies of the original recordings are part of the Texas Digital Archive.

Arrangement:
The records are arranged in three groups: sound recordings, video recordings, and motion picture recordings. Sound recordings is further arranged into five subgroups: broadcast reports, conference recordings, interviews, public service announcements, and other recordings. Video recordings is arranged into two subgroups: broadcast reports and unedited footage. Motion picture recordings is arranged into four subgroups: John C. White news releases, "Cooking Texas Style," Silent news release footage, and Promotional films. Within each subgroup the records are arranged in roughly alphabetical order and chronologically within that order.
